1998 Daihatsu Cuore vs. 1992 Toyota Camry

To start off, 1998 Daihatsu Cuore is newer by 6 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1992 Toyota Camry.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1992 Toyota Camry would be higher. At 2,958 cc (6 cylinders), 1992 Toyota Camry is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1992 Toyota Camry (188 HP @ 5400 RPM) has 149 more horse power than 1998 Daihatsu Cuore. (39 HP @ 5500 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1992 Toyota Camry should accelerate faster than 1998 Daihatsu Cuore.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1992 Toyota Camry weights approximately 710 kg more than 1998 Daihatsu Cuore.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1992 Toyota Camry (255 Nm @ 4400 RPM) has 190 more torque (in Nm) than 1998 Daihatsu Cuore. (65 Nm @ 3200 RPM). This means 1992 Toyota Camry will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1998 Daihatsu Cuore.

Compare all specifications:

1998 Daihatsu Cuore 1992 Toyota Camry
Make Daihatsu Toyota
Model Cuore Camry
Year Released 1998 1992
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 845 cc 2958 cc
Engine Cylinders 3 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Horse Power 39 HP 188 HP
Engine RPM 5500 RPM 5400 RPM
Torque 65 Nm 255 Nm
Torque RPM 3200 RPM 4400 RPM
Engine Compression Ratio 9.5:1 9.6:1
Drive Type Front Front
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 5 doors 4 doors
Vehicle Weight 800 kg 1510 kg
Vehicle Length 3420 mm 4730 mm
Vehicle Width 1480 mm 1780 mm
Vehicle Height 1430 mm 1430 mm
Wheelbase Size 2290 mm 2560 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 32 L 70 L
